They say that game recognizes game, so it should perhaps come as no surprise that Kansas City Chiefs quarterback Patrick Mahomes has been full of praise for Eagles signal-caller Jalen Hurts following Super Bowl LVII.

Speaking to reporters following the game, Mahomes made sure to highlight just how excellent his Philly counterpart played in the biggest game of his life.

“If there were any doubters left there shouldn’t be now. The way he stepped on this stage, and ran, threw the ball, whatever it took for his team to win. I mean, that was a special performance,” Mahomes said of Hurts

“I don’t want it to get lost in the loss that they had. I mean, even whenever we got all the momentum in that game, and we went up eight points in the fourth quarter, for him to respond and move his team down the football field and run in himself in a two-point conversion, it was a special performance by him and I mean, you make sure you appreciate that when you look back on this game.”

In Super Bowl LVII, both Mahomes and Hurts put forth MVP performances, with Mahomes only taking home the prize because he was on the winning team.

Mahomes, who was ultimately named MVP, completed 21 of 27 passes for 182 yards and three touchdowns, while Hurts completed 27 of 38 passes for 304 yards and a touchdown. Hurts also rushed for three more touchdowns and 70 yards, which is a Super Bowl record for a QB.

Luckily for fans of the NFL, we won’t have to wait long to see Mahomes and Hurts play again as the defending Super Bowl champion Chiefs are set to host the Eagles at Arrowhead next season.
